What owners actually said

5 reports
Mileage unknown · Jun 5, 2000
Seats

LATCH DOES NOT LOCK SEAT IN AN UPRIGHT POSITION. *AK

NHTSA ODI #863030

Mileage unknown · Apr 30, 1999
Vehicle Speed ControlCrash

WAS BACKING OUT OF PARKING SPACE SLOWLY, SUDDENLY THE VEHICLE ACCELERATED IN REVERSE. HAD FOOT ON BRAKES WHEN BACKING UP. HIT A COUPLE OF VEHICLES BEFORE TURNING IGNITION OFF. *AK

NHTSA ODI #837308

Mileage unknown · Apr 15, 1999
Seats

THE REAR SEATBELT WILL NOT LOCK DOWN. IF THERE WAS A RECALL ON SEATBELTS FOR A 1984 JIMMY 4 X 4 , I WOULD LIKE INFORMATION ON SEATBELTS OR HOW IT CAN BE FIXED. I AM SCARED FOR MY CHILDRENS SAFETY. PLEASE LET ME KNOW ANY INFORMATION THAT CAN HELP. THANK YOU.

NHTSA ODI #705654

Mileage unknown · Mar 2, 1999
Power TrainFire

FRONT OIL SEAL ON THE TRANSMISSION POPPED OUT, LEAKING OIL WHICH CAUSED A FIRE. *AK

NHTSA ODI #835403

Mileage unknown · Oct 15, 1996
Seat Belts

SEAT BELT RETRACTOR INOPERATIVE.

NHTSA ODI #509912

PE87003 · Elect. Failures/fires

Opened Oct 27, 1986 · Closed Jul 16, 1987

Status: closed (inferred from source dates) · Electrical System

SUMMARY OF INFORMATION FROM THE MANUFACTURER: FORD HAS SUBMITTED 40 OWNERCOMPLAINTS WHICH ALLEGE IN-DASH FIRES. IT DOES NOT BELIEVE THAT THECOMPLAINTS INDICATE A DEFECT NOR ARE THEY SAFETY RELATED.ANALYSIS:A REVIEW OF THE COMPLAINTS WAS CONDUCTED.VARIOUS COMPONENTSWERE ALLEGED TO HAVE BEEN THE SOURCE OF THE FIRES.THE FAN MOTOR, BLOWERRESISTOR, WIRING, INSULATION, AND THE A/C CONTROL MODULE HAVE BEEN REPORTEDAS DEFECTIVE.THERE IS NO PATTERN OF DEFECT.NO REPORTED INJURIESSTATUS:CLOSED 6/30/87.======
